Instructing Your Texas Heeler: Tips for Success

Owning a Texas Heeler is an enjoyable experience. These dogs are smart and devoted. However, they also have a strong energy and require consistent training to become well-behaved companions.

The key to successfully training your Texas Heeler is to start soon and be patient. They respond best to reward-based methods.

Here are some tips to help you get started:

  • Expose your puppy to a variety of people, places, and sounds from a early age.
  • Enroll your dog in an obedience class. This will give them a chance to master basic commands in a controlled environment.
  • Be clear with your commands and incentivize good behavior. Avoid using punishment as it can damage your dog's self-belief.
  • Provide plenty of physical and mental stimulation. Texas Heelers are high-energy dogs that need movement.
  • Explore activities like agility, herding trials, or dock diving to stimulate their minds and bodies.

With patience, consistency, and positive reinforcement, you can train your Texas Heeler to be a well-behaved, happy, and loyal companion.
